A British hacker, Marcus Hutchins, was in the airport on his way home from the Def Con Hacking convention when he was detained by FBI agents. He was charged with helping to create and sell malicious code known as Kronos and the UPAS Kit, software that facilitated hacking. This malware was designed to target banking information and to work on many types of web browsers, including Internet Explorer, Firefox, and Chrome. The hacker was kept in custody for many months before being released in July last year with one year of supervised release. In 2017, Mr. Hutchins was credited with stopping the famous WannaCry virus from expanding through the NHS. He is also an avid cyber security expert and known ethical hacker.
